Output 750cd16181dc63f1a0580ac077386d4d0ea6ac0e4f113f1c505166d205fa0781:0

value
6963653683129
script pubkey
OP_0 OP_PUSHBYTES_20 66f90b9f06339c847dbbaa899697d073ceda3bd5
address
tb1qvmush8cxxwwggldm42yed97sw08d5w743a0qkt
transaction
750cd16181dc63f1a0580ac077386d4d0ea6ac0e4f113f1c505166d205fa0781
spent
true